# RotaryVault — internal secrets-rotation utility (Penwick Labs).
# Reviewer notes: this env file is consumed at container start and never
# logged. Rotation cadence and vault endpoint are set in rotary.toml, not
# here; only the bootstrap credential lives in this file. Confirm file
# mode is 0600 before approving. The bootstrap credential line follows immediately below.

secret setting of yagef-baweg: RELAY_SECRET29=cb53deb59a49ed54d9f43599b54ca

Step 3: Deploy the Quellbird alert deduplicator to the staging cluster. Run the smoke suite first; it replays a sample pager storm and asserts that duplicate alerts collapse within the five-second window. If the suite passes, promote the build via the Harkwell pipeline. The pipeline requires a signed release manifest before it will promote anything. Sign the manifest using the key below.

rollout seal: bky4_DFM9

Ticket: Vault locked after token refresh bug

Plugin authors: the Brindlekit session-token refresh fails silently after 12h, locking the extension vault. Fix ships next release. Workaround: clear cached tokens, restart the host. If the vault stays sealed, manual unseal is required using the recovery passphrase that follows:

strongbox words: prawyn-fenmir

## Support

The Fernwheel transcoding farm is operated by the Media Pipelines team at Oakmere Labs. Before filing a ticket, check the farm dashboard for node saturation and the job queue for stuck encodes older than two hours. Most failures trace to malformed source containers; the validator logs will name the offending asset. Include the job ID, preset name, and worker pool in any report. Urgent capacity issues during a live event should go straight to the on-duty pipeline operator.

escalation mailbox, bafog-fafog: ulador@paliqlabs.internal